Schedule of Events

Save The Planet Summer Camp is located at Audubon Park Covenant Church located in Audubon Park, Florida at 3219 Chelsea St, Orlando, FL 32803. This summer camp runs from June 112th - 16th & June 25th - 29th 2023, with 5-days of activities  for each of 2 different age groups:
  • June 12th - 16th: Kindergarten - 2nd Grade
    • 9:00 am - 4:00 pm
      • ​Zero Waste Snack & T-Shirt Included
  • June 25th - 29th: 3rd - 5th Grade 
    • 9:00 am - 4:00 pm
      • ​Zero Waste Snack & T-Shirt Included​
Each day will include 7+ hours of environmental lessons including breaks in-between as well as a craft, hands-on activity, and game!
All of these lessons are created to be fun, engaging, and inclusive of campers' voices and ideas.
Lessons include bilingual vocabulary and cultural information such as information about native Florida tribes, history, and more!
Picture
Day 1: Energy​ ​
Day 2: Water​
Day 3: Food​
Day 4: Waste​
Day 5: Ecology​

Supplies Offered To Students

Save the Planet Summer Campers will take home the following items as part of their summer camp:

Supplies include:
- 1 waste bucket
- Soil, seeds, & pots
- Renewable energy crafts
- Shower timer
- Coloring sheets & worksheets
- & more!

Parent Involvement

Interested parents are welcome to be present during the summer camp to answer questions, help with crafts if needed, and supervise children during the camp activities.  Parent supervision is not required. If you have further questions on this, please reach out to our team.
